How they compare

Germany currently reports 51.8% against 51.7% in Cook Islands, a difference of 0.1%.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 18 shared years of data; in 2005 it was Cook Islands ahead.

Cook Islands ranks 132nd and Germany ranks 131st of 247 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Cook Islands averaged higher in 1 and Germany in 2.
